Knowing the Procedure: How Road Resurfacing Operates

The road resurfacing method generally begins with careful preparation. First, the existing layer is typically cleaned and any loose aggregate is removed. Next, a milling machine may be used to shave off the top portion of the old pavement, creating a fresh substrate for the new coating. After this, a bonding primer is often applied to ensure proper adhesion. Then, new asphalt or other surfacing compound is spread and compacted using rollers to create a smooth, durable finish. Finally, any markings, such as lane lines or traffic signals, are replaced, completing the job. This whole procedure aims to enhance the road's safety and longevity.

Minimizing Disruption: What to See During Road Repaving

Road resurfacing projects are essential for maintaining safe and smooth roadways, but they can inevitably lead to some level of inconvenience. While the process, you might notice lane closures, temporary detours, and reduced speed limits. The work typically involves milling up the existing asphalt – a process which can generate noise and dust – followed by laying down fresh paving materials. Expect some vibrations from machinery as the new surface is compacted; crews often work during daytime hours to minimize nighttime disturbance, but certain phases may require late night operations. Project duration varies depending on road length and complexity, with updates frequently available through local government websites or traffic apps – staying informed helps to manage your travel plans and lessen any potential frustration.
